Local customs rules and import taxes in 2026

When shipping to the Philippines, it is important to remember the de minimis rule. As of 2026, shipments with a total value under 10,000 PHP are generally exempt from import duties and taxes. Since a single Jellycat pouch is well below this threshold, you likely won't have to worry about extra Bureau of Customs fees unless you are importing a very large haul.
